- The distance between Satu Mare, Romania and Greenwood, Ns, Canada is approximately 6,359 km or 3,951 mi.
- To reach Satu Mare in this distance one would set out from Greenwood, Ns bearing 53° or NE and follow the great circles arc to approach Satu Mare bearing 122.8° or ESE .
- Satu Mare has a marine west coast climate (Cfb) whereas Greenwood, Ns has a warm summer continental/ hemiboreal climate with no dry season (Dfb).
- Satu Mare is in or near the cool temperate moist forest biome whereas Greenwood, Ns is in or near the cool temperate wet forest biome.
- The mean temperature is 3.8 °C (6.8°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 1.8 °C (3.2°F) less in Satu Mare. The continentality subtype is subcontinental for both.
- Total annual precipitation averages 466.3 mm (18.4 in) less which is equivalent to 466.3 l/m² (11.44 US gal/ft²) or 4,663,000 l/ha (498,506 US gal/ac) less. About 4/7 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 2.8° lower in Satu Mare than in Greenwood, Ns.
